Kohler Announces Wind Power Investment
KOHLER, WIS.—Kohler Co. announced a 15-year agreement to purchase 100 megawatts of wind power per year from the Diamond Vista wind farm located near Salina, Kansas.
Enel Green Power North America will construct the project this year and will be the long-term owner and operator of the nearly 300 MW wind project. Enel acquired Diamond Vista from Kansas-based renewable energy developer Tradewind Energy.

ChlorKing Upgrades NEXGEN On-site Chlorine Generators
NORCROSS, GA.—ChlorKing has reduced scheduled manual-cleaning requirements for its NEXGEN on-site chlorine generators with the introduction of five new models with self-cleaning capability. The upgraded NEXGENs automatically begin a cleaning cycle every three hours to remove calcium deposits from the electrically-charged plates that convert a mild saline solution to chlorine to sanitize swimming pools. The new models have daily chlorine-production capacities of 10, 20, 40, 60, and 80 pounds, respectively.

EarthTronics Introduces High-Definition Adjustable LED
MUSKEGON, MICH.—EarthTronics, dedicated to developing innovative energy-efficient lighting products that provide a positive economic and environmental impact, introduces its new LED Color Changing Panels with a unique high-definition color tunable design to precisely adjust both the color temperature and the light level in office, retail, educational and commercial applications.
The LED Color Changing Panels can be fine-tuned from a warm 3000K color experience to a cool, natural 5000K color.
